We mentioned in our hint two weeks ago that his career came to an abrupt end in the early 1990s. And it did. Phil D'Agostino retired as Southington's police chief in April 1991 and was arrested less than two years later for allegedly assigning on-duty officers to run personal errands for him. He was a veteran member of the police force before succeeding Joe Sollack as chief in 1983. A town native, he graduated from Lewis High in 1947 and, at 79, still lives in Southington.
